Freudenberg Performance Materials: Polyurethane foams for wound care
Freudenberg Performance Materials is using MD&M East to tout several polyurethane foams for advanced would care:There’s a polyurethane foam with a direct layer of silicone coating, which prevents a dressing from sticking to a wound while adhering to healthy skin.
Freudenberg Performance Materials combined hydrophilic PU foams and hydroactive nonwovens for wound dressings. The multi-layer components with superabsorbent nonwovens increase the absorption and retention performance of wound dressings, according to the company.
There’s a new high-performance formulation based on MDI polyurethane. In wound dressings for chronic venous leg ulcers, the new MDI-based PU foam absorbs wound fluids in just a few seconds, according to the company. It also has a fluid retention capacity that is around 50% higher than that of TDI-based polyurethane foam and greater strength in its wet state.
